HARPER, Kan. (CNN/Lee Pence) - This Midwest couple didn't let something like two nearby tornadoes stop them from getting married.
Caleb and Candra Pence finished the ceremony at a Kansas farmhouse over the weekend as the twisters could be seen touching down about eight miles away.
The bride says the twisters made for great wedding pictures.
Caleb is a bull rider and Candra a barrel racer and they met at a rodeo.
